Foundation Lifting in Willow Grove, PA
Foundation lifting services involve the process of raising and stabilizing a building’s foundation to address issues caused by settling, shifting, or soil movement. These services are commonly requested for residential properties experiencing uneven floors, cracked walls, or sticking doors and windows. Property owners typically seek foundation lifting to restore structural integrity, prevent further damage, and improve the safety and value of their homes. Projects can range from small adjustments to significant lifts for entire structures, and understanding the scope of work, potential costs, and the condition of the existing foundation are important considerations before requesting these services.
Homeowners considering foundation lifting should evaluate the extent of foundation movement and consult with professionals to determine the most appropriate approach. It’s useful to understand the types of underpinning or jacking methods used, as well as the expected impact on property access during the process. Clarifying whether repairs will be necessary after lifting and how the work might affect landscaping or existing structures can help property owners plan accordingly. Proper assessment and planning ensure that foundation lifting effectively addresses underlying issues and supports long-term stability.

Common Foundation Lifting Jobs
Foundation Stabilization - techniques to prevent or halt ongoing foundation movement.
Interior Piering - lifting and supporting sinking or settling slabs inside the home.
Exterior Underpinning - strengthening foundation walls to improve stability and prevent cracks.
Mudjacking - raising sunken concrete slabs with a soil-based mixture to restore level surfaces.
Slab Jacking - lifting and leveling concrete floors or driveways affected by settling.
Crack Repair - sealing and reinforcing foundation cracks to prevent further damage.
Foundation Lifting Questions
What is foundation lifting? Foundation lifting is a process that raises and stabilizes a building's foundation to correct settling or unevenness.
When is foundation lifting needed? It is typically needed when cracks, uneven floors, or doors and windows that stick are observed due to shifting soil or settling.
What methods are used for foundation lifting? Common methods include underpinning with piers or jacks to lift and support the foundation securely.
Will foundation lifting fix structural issues? Yes, it can address foundation settlement and help prevent further damage, improving overall stability.
